| typedef struct tty {
 | |
|   int tty_events;		/* set when TTY should inspect this line */
 | |
|   int tty_index;		/* index into TTY table */
 | |
|   int tty_minor;		/* device minor number */
 | |
| 
 | |
|   /* Input queue.  Typed characters are stored here until read by a program. */
 | |
|   u16_t *tty_inhead;		/* pointer to place where next char goes */
 | |
|   u16_t *tty_intail;		/* pointer to next char to be given to prog */
 | |
|   int tty_incount;		/* # chars in the input queue */
 | |
|   int tty_eotct;		/* number of "line breaks" in input queue */
 | |
|   devfun_t tty_devread;		/* routine to read from low level buffers */
 | |
|   devfun_t tty_icancel;		/* cancel any device input */
 | |
|   int tty_min;			/* minimum requested #chars in input queue */
 | |
|   timer_t tty_tmr;		/* the timer for this tty */
 | |
| 
 | |
|   /* Output section. */
 | |
|   devfun_t tty_devwrite;	/* routine to start actual device output */
 | |
|   devfunarg_t tty_echo;		/* routine to echo characters input */
 | |
|   devfun_t tty_ocancel;		/* cancel any ongoing device output */
 | |
|   devfun_t tty_break;		/* let the device send a break */
 | |
| 
 | |
|   /* Terminal parameters and status. */
 | |
|   int tty_position;		/* current position on the screen for echoing */
 | |
|   char tty_reprint;		/* 1 when echoed input messed up, else 0 */
 | |
|   char tty_escaped;		/* 1 when LNEXT (^V) just seen, else 0 */
 | |
|   char tty_inhibited;		/* 1 when STOP (^S) just seen (stops output) */
 | |
|   endpoint_t tty_pgrp;		/* endpoint of controlling process */
 | |
|   char tty_openct;		/* count of number of opens of this tty */
 | |
| 
 | |
|   /* Information about incomplete I/O requests is stored here. */
 | |
|   int tty_inrepcode;		/* reply code, TASK_REPLY or REVIVE */
 | |
|   char tty_inrevived;		/* set to 1 if revive callback is pending */
 | |
|   endpoint_t tty_incaller;	/* process that made the call (usually VFS) */
 | |
|   endpoint_t tty_inproc;	/* process that wants to read from tty */
 | |
|   cp_grant_id_t tty_ingrant;	/* grant where data is to go */
 | |
|   vir_bytes tty_inoffset;	/* offset into grant */
 | |
|   int tty_inleft;		/* how many chars are still needed */
 | |
|   int tty_incum;		/* # chars input so far */
 | |
|   int tty_outrepcode;		/* reply code, TASK_REPLY or REVIVE */
 | |
|   int tty_outrevived;		/* set to 1 if revive callback is pending */
 | |
|   endpoint_t tty_outcaller;	/* process that made the call (usually VFS) */
 | |
|   endpoint_t tty_outproc;	/* process that wants to write to tty */
 | |
|   cp_grant_id_t tty_outgrant;	/* grant where data comes from */
 | |
|   vir_bytes tty_outoffset;	/* offset into grant */
 | |
|   int tty_outleft;		/* # chars yet to be output */
 | |
|   int tty_outcum;		/* # chars output so far */
 | |
|   endpoint_t tty_iocaller;	/* process that made the call (usually VFS) */
 | |
|   int tty_iorevived;		/* set to 1 if revive callback is pending */
 | |
|   endpoint_t tty_ioproc;	/* process that wants to do an ioctl */
 | |
|   int tty_iostatus;		/* result */
 | |
|   int tty_ioreq;		/* ioctl request code */
 | |
|   cp_grant_id_t tty_iogrant;	/* virtual address of ioctl buffer or grant */
 | |
| 
 | |
|   /* select() data */
 | |
|   int tty_select_ops;		/* which operations are interesting */
 | |
|   endpoint_t tty_select_proc;	/* which process wants notification */
 | |
| 
 | |
|   /* Miscellaneous. */
 | |
|   devfun_t tty_ioctl;		/* set line speed, etc. at the device level */
 | |
|   devfun_t tty_close;		/* tell the device that the tty is closed */
 | |
|   void *tty_priv;		/* pointer to per device private data */
 | |
|   struct termios tty_termios;	/* terminal attributes */
 | |
|   struct winsize tty_winsize;	/* window size (#lines and #columns) */
 | |
| 
 | |
|   u16_t tty_inbuf[TTY_IN_BYTES];/* tty input buffer */
 | |
| 
 | |
| } tty_t;

| /* Values for the fields. */
 | |
| #define NOT_ESCAPED        0	/* previous character is not LNEXT (^V) */
 | |
| #define ESCAPED            1	/* previous character was LNEXT (^V) */
 | |
| #define RUNNING            0	/* no STOP (^S) has been typed to stop output */
 | |
| #define STOPPED            1	/* STOP (^S) has been typed to stop output */
 | |
| 
 | |
| /* Fields and flags on characters in the input queue. */
 | |
| #define IN_CHAR       0x00FF	/* low 8 bits are the character itself */
 | |
| #define IN_LEN        0x0F00	/* length of char if it has been echoed */
 | |
| #define IN_LSHIFT          8	/* length = (c & IN_LEN) >> IN_LSHIFT */
 | |
| #define IN_EOT        0x1000	/* char is a line break (^D, LF) */
 | |
| #define IN_EOF        0x2000	/* char is EOF (^D), do not return to user */
 | |
| #define IN_ESC        0x4000	/* escaped by LNEXT (^V), no interpretation */
